SHIPPENSBURG FIRE DEPARTMENT STANDARD ADMINISTRATIVE GUIDELINE Title: NEW MEMBER ORIENTATION Date: 11/30/10 SAG # 1.05 Page 1 of 1 Purpose: To ensure that all personnel receive the proper training before riding fire apparatus and becoming interior firefighters. Applicability: For all Shippensburg Fire Department personnel who intend to ride fire apparatus and become interior firefighters. Policy: 1.0 New Members 1.1 All new members who intend to ride fire apparatus and participate in fire/rescue activities must go through this orientation. 1.2 All Chief Officers will ensure that their personnel are working at their current training level. 1.3 Each new member will receive the attached packet. A senior firefighter or officer will be assigned as a mentor through this process. 1.4 As the new member is ready to ride fire apparatus or to become an interior firefighter, a memo will be posted at their respective station of their new status. 1.5 The appropriate helmet color designation will be worn until the training level is completed.

Shippensburg Fire Department New Member Orientation Station # Requirements to Ride Fire Apparatus as an Exterior Firefighter: Complete New Member Checklist Hazardous Material Operations Level Responder (an online Awareness Level Course is acceptable until the responder is able to attend an Operation Level Course) CPR Approved by Station Chief Job objectives of an Exterior Firefighter: Includes All Junior Members Operational Duties shall be limited to exterior operations, working under the direct supervision of the Incident Commander, Unit Officer or Driver/Operator. The member shall not be counted toward apparatus staffing. The member shall not operate in an IDLH atmosphere or within the collapse zone of an incident. The member shall not don SCBA for operational use, except for training. The member shall concede their seat to any interior member should there be no other seats available on the apparatus. The member shall have identification on their helmet that identifies the individual as an exterior firefighter. Requirements to Ride Fire Apparatus as an Interior Firefighter: Complete Entry Level Firefighter Curriculum Hazardous Material Operational Level CPR/AED Job objectives of an Interior Firefighter: The member can act as a part of team performing search/rescue, fire attack, and ventilation. The member can operate SCBA in IDLH atmosphere. The member needs to work directly with the unit officer.
